The tree is characterized by high vigor and a dense crown; the branches have a tendency to bend under the weight of the fruit. The leaves are dark green and elliptical-lanceolate in shape. The fruits, weighing about 5 grams, have an asymmetric shape with a characteristic protrusion at the tip and turn wine-purple or reddish-black upon ripening.
The variety is self-incompatible and needs pollinators such as Leccino or Pendolino. The plant has good rooting ability and resistance to cold and Spilocaea oleaginea, but is susceptible to the olive fruit fly. Fruiting may be irregular; the maturity period is late and prolonged.
